Chryso’s Innovative Green Solutions
Chryso’s product portfolio delivers high-performance, eco-friendly solutions that support the industry’s transition to sustainable practices:
- EnviroAdd™ Cement Activators – Enhancing blended cements like Type IL Portland Limestone Cement (PLC), reducing clinker content and minimizing carbon emissions.
- Chryso®Convert C – A breakthrough in waste reduction, transforming leftover plastic concrete into reusable hardened aggregate, cutting material disposal costs.
- Quad™ Solution – Supporting the circular economy by optimizing challenging aggregates while reducing environmental impact and production costs.
- EnviroMix® Range – Admixtures designed to lower concrete’s carbon footprint while ensuring superior strength and durability.
- Strux® Fibers – High-performance macro synthetic fibers that replace welded wire mesh, enhancing crack control and reducing reliance on traditional reinforcement materials.
- Chryso®Optima – High-range water-reducing admixtures that improve workability over long transport distances, minimizing material waste and energy use.
Expanding Local Infrastructure for a Greener Future
Chryso’s investment in Canada includes new facilities and enhanced regional support to accelerate sustainable construction:
- Concrete Application Labs in Montreal and Calgary – These state-of-the-art labs enable localized R&D, allowing customers to collaborate with Chryso experts to develop greener, more cost-effective building solutions.
- Expanded Manufacturing and Distribution – With existing production sites in Vancouver and Montreal and a third facility set to open in Toronto, Chryso is strengthening its ability to provide sustainable materials efficiently, reducing transportation emissions and supply chain delays.
